    Abstract: Spraying equipment for plants growing in parallel rows comprises a main horizontal air duct and several secondary ducts extending therefrom in downward direction between the rows of plants. Each duct is provided with air outlets directed towards the plants, which are alternately opened and closed by valves so as to eject the air in pulses. One spray nozzle each is positioned in the center of each air outlet serving to eject into the pulsating air stream a jet of spraying fluid which is thereby carried onto the plants covering these from top to bottom. The equipment is attached to the front or rear of a tractor which carries a supply of spraying fluid and a pump serving to supply the material to each nozzle through piping. A blower is positioned in the main duct supplying air under pressure to the secondary ducts and to the air outlets.

  • Patent number: 4896563
    Abstract: A hydraulic-mechanical transmission for a heavy vehicle as shown in FIG. 5 includes a hydraulic variable-displacement pump (I) supplying fluid under pressure to two hydraulic, variable-displacement motors (II, III), controlled by valves (64, 65). It further includes a planetary gear (IV) enclosed in a casing (1) which can be driven by one of the motors (II) through a pinion (51) and an external ring gear (10). The second motor (III) can drive the casing (1) which latter is mounted direct on the motor shaft (40). A planet carrier (2) can be coupled to the casing (1) by a clutch (33) or is freely movable in the casing. A sun gear (31) is mounted on an output shaft (3), while the planet gears (20) engage with an internal gear (11) of the casing. Three speeds and torques are available by respectively driving the planetary gear by either motor or by both motors together and by alternately coupling the planet carrier to the casing or having it freely rotating by operation of the clutch.

  • Patent number: 4858329
    Abstract: A surveying and mapping implement indicates the level differences of the ground over which it travels, in relation to the distance travelled. It comprises a carriage consisting of a swivelling front wheel, two center wheels attached to the outside of a U-shaped vertical frame, and two rear wheels connected to the U-shaped frame by means of a thill and a universal joint positioned co-extensive with the axis of the center wheels. The universal joint permits the rear wheels to move up and down and sideways, as well as to twist in relation to the center wheels. The wheel base between the center wheels and the front wheel is identical with that between the center wheels and the rear wheels, in order to facilitate calculations.

  • Patent number: 4720965
    Abstract: A device for attachment to an uprooting implement is designed for compacting plant residue into cylindrical or rope-like shape and to cut the compacted cylinder into short wafers. The device comprises four rollers in parallel alignment symmetrically positioned around a central space defining the compacted cylinder, and urged toward the central space by springs. The rollers are positioned with their axes in the direction of travel of the uprooting implement and all are rotated in the same sense of rotation. Each roller has a cylindrical rear portion and a frusto-conical front portion provided with a broadthreaded screw, the screws serving to press the plant residue into the space between the cylindrical roller portions. Conveyor means are provided for feeding the plants into the compacting device, and cutting means are provided to the rear of the rollers.
